在Linux上用命令怎么连接数据库

在Linux上用命令怎么连接数据库,第1张

以常见的mysql和oracle这两种数据库为例:

一、连接mysql(mysql服务已开启)

1、mysql数据库安装在本机,则直接敲入命令mysql

-u

root

-p即可。

2、mysql数据库不是安装在本机,则需要加参数,常用参数如下:

1),-h,指定目标ip地址

2),-u,指定登录用户名。

3),-p,指定密码,密码可以接在-p后面输入mysql

-uroot

-p123456。也可以mysql

-uroot

-p回车等提示输入密码时输入,这样输入密码没有回显。

二、连接oracle数据库

1、若当前用户为root用户,则需要执行命令

su

-

oracle切换至oracle用户;若当前用户为oracle用户则此步骤省略。

2、若oracle安装在本机,则在oracle用户下直接执行sqlplus

username/password(username,password替换成真实的用户名和密码),若提示connected则表示连接成功;

3、若oracle安装在其他机器,则在oracle用户下执行sqlplus

username/password@//host:port/sid。host为oracle所在机器的ip或者机器名,port为端口号,通常为1521,sid指oracle的实例名。

扩展资料:

linux下 *** 作数据库(以mysql为例)的其他命令

一、linux下查看mysql服务的命令两种方式:

1、[root@localhost

bin]ps

-ef|grep

mysql

2、[root@localhost

bin]netstat

-nlp

二、linux下启动mysql服务的两种方式:

1、命令方式:

[root@localhost

bin]cd

/usr/bin

[root@localhost

bin]./mysqld_safe

&

2、服务方式:

[root@localhost

~]service

mysql

start

如果服务在启动状态,直接重启服务用以下命令:[root@localhost

~]service

mysql

restart

三、linux下关闭mysql服务的两种方式:

1、命令方式:

[root@localhost

~]mysqladmin

-u

root

shutdown

2、服务方式:

[root@localhost

~]service

mysql

stop

参考资料:mysql官方文档

Derby插件工具可以连接derby数据库

下载Eclipse的Derby插件,包括:derby_core_plugin derby_ui_plugin

解压缩并复制到eclipse目录下。重启Eclipse目录。鼠标选择项目,然后鼠标右键,选择Properties说明安装成功。

为项目增加Derby插件支持。选择Add Apache Derby nature。

然后启动derby数据库服务器。启动derby数据库客户端ij。通过ij创建并连接到服务器端:

connect 'jdbc:derby://localhost:1527/helloworldcreate=trueusername=testpassword=test'

连接到名为helloworld的数据库

地址为:localhost:1527

create=true,如果不存在这个数据库,就在服务器端创建

username=testpassword=test,用户名/密码为test,如果是新建数据库将新建用户和密码。

Derby的SQL脚本:create.sql,内容:

create table books(

id int generated always as identity,

name varchar(32) not null,

PRICE DECIMAL(6,2),

constraint P_Key_1 primary key (id)

)

执行脚本的命令:

run 'create.sql'

1.程序中创建数据库时,如果没有指定目录,会默认在项目的根目录下,生成一个以derby数据库名的目录,如:

Class.forName("org.apache.derby.jdbc.EmbeddedDriver").newInstance()

System.out.println("Load the embedded driver")

Connection conn = null

Properties props = new Properties()

props.put("user", "test")

props.put("password", "test")

// create and connect the database named helloDB

conn = DriverManager.getConnection(

"jdbc:derby:testDBcreate=true", props)

System.out.println("create and connect to testDB")

conn.setAutoCommit(true)

其中:“jdbc:derby:testDBcreate=true”,则在项目根目录下生成一个testDB目录。

2.下载安装coolsql后, *** 作如下:

1>新建一个书签,选择驱动

找到derby-10.9.1.0.jar(或其他版本jar),选择下面的:org.apache.derby.jdbc.EmbeddedDriver 。

2>下一步,输入用户名、密码,填写程序中赋值的:test,test;下面的数据库名字填写时,要注意,写系统的绝对路径,如:E:\eclipse3.7\wordspace_mvn\staticize\testDB(staticize为项目根目录),下面的url:jdbc:derby:E:\eclipse3.7\wordspace_mvn\staticize\testDB(自动填写)。

3>保持连接就可以了。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/yw/9017032.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-24
下一篇 2023-04-24

发表评论

登录后才能评论

评论列表(0条)

保存